We all know what a red flag looks like in theory. But in practice, our brains are remarkably skilled at reframing them into something safer. In this episode: the specific psychological machinery behind why we explain away early warning signs — cognitive dissonance, identity protection, the virtuous rationalization trap — and one concrete exercise that cuts through the noise.
